Nanoscale materials are increasingly used to solve the fundamental problems and in applied biomedical research. The most well studied toxicity, biodistribution and biophysical properties of gold nanoparticles. They occupy a special place among the nanoscale materials used for diagnostic and therapeutic purposes, actively investigated as a nanosized tools for optical or magnetic imaging of cells and tissues, as carriers how of medicinal products for human and animal diagnostic preparations of the new generation. In the making of new drugs, the study of placental permeability barrier for them, as a rule, limited to the parameters of the general and selective toxicity study cellular responses mother and fetus, the nearest and distant teratogenicity. Nanotechnology can offer to solve the problem with more informative methods associated with drug conjugates. Nanopharmaceutics drugs can help in studies of mechanisms not only of placental permeability, but also of other blood-tissue barriers...
